CString::Compare

int ºñ±³ ( LPCTSTR lpsz ) const;

¹Ýȯ °ª

¹®ÀÚ¿­ÀÌ µ¿ÀÏÇÑ °æ¿ì 0, lt; ÀÌ CString °³Ã¼´Â CString °³Ã¼ lpsz¶Ç´ÂÀÌ °æ¿ì > 0 º¸´Ù ÀÛÀº °æ¿ì 0 lpsz º¸´Ù Å®´Ï´Ù.

¸Å°³ º¯¼ö

lpsz

ºñ±³¿¡ »ç¿ë µÇ´Â ´Ù¸¥ ¹®ÀÚ¿­¡£

ÁÖÀÇ

ÀÏ¹Ý ÅØ½ºÆ® ÇÔ¼ö _tcscmp¸¦ »ç¿ë ÇÏ ¿© ´Ù¸¥ ¹®ÀÚ¿­·ÎÀÌ CString °³Ã¼¸¦ ºñ±³ ÇÕ´Ï´Ù. ÀÏ¹Ý ÅØ½ºÆ® ÇÔ¼ö _tcscmp, TCHAR¿¡ Á¤ÀÇ µË´Ï´Ù.H, strcmp, wcscmp, ¶Ç´Â _mbscmp ¿¡¼­ Á¤ÀÇ µÇ´Â ¹®ÀÚ ÁýÇÕ¿¡ µû¶ó Áöµµ ÄÄÆÄÀÏ ½Ã°£. À̵é ÇÔ¼ö´Â ¹®ÀÚ¿­ÀÇ ´ë/¼Ò¹®ÀÚ ±¸ºÐ ºñ±³¸¦ ¼öÇà ÇÏ °í ·ÎÄÉÀÏÀÇ ¿µÇâÀ» ¹ÞÁö ¾Ê½À´Ï´Ù. ÀÚ¼¼ÇÑ ³»¿ëÀº ÂüÁ¶ strcmp, wcscmp, _mbscmp¿¡¼­ ·±Å¸ÀÓ ¶óÀ̺귯¸® ÂüÁ¶¡£

¿¹Á¦

´ÙÀ½ ¿¹Á¦¿¡¼­´Â CString::Compare ¸¦ »ç¿ë ÇÏ ¿©¡£

/ / Cstring::compare¿¡ ´ë ÇÑ ¿¹Á¦
CString s1 ("abc");
CString s2 ("abd");
ASSERT (s1.ºñ±³ (s2) =-1); / / ´Ù¸¥ Cstring¿Í ºñ±³ ÇÕ´Ï´Ù.
ASSERT (s1.ºñ±³ ("¾Æº£") =-1); / / LPTSTR ¹®ÀÚ¿­ ºñ±³

CString °³¿ä |nbsp; Ŭ·¡½º ¸â¹ö (ko) | °èÃþ ±¸Á¶ Â÷Æ®(&N)

Âü°í Ç׸ñnbsp;CString::CompareNoCase, CString::Collate, CString::CollateNoCase(&N)

Index